Let’s dive into some inspiring ideas that will spark your creativity!1. Geometric Patterns for a Modern TouchGeometric wall patterns are a great way to add a contemporary feel to your living room. Think triangles, hexagons, or even 3D shapes that create visual interest. You can use wallpaper, stencils, or paint to achieve this look. For example, a navy blue and white geometric pattern can make a bold statement and serve as a stunning focal point.2. Floral and Nature-Inspired DesignsIf you want to bring the outdoors inside, consider floral or nature-inspired wall patterns. Soft, botanical prints can create a serene atmosphere, making your living room feel light and airy. You might opt for a large mural featuring lush greenery or delicate floral wallpaper that wraps around your space.3. Stripes for a Timeless AppealStripes are a classic choice that never goes out of style. They can make a room feel taller or wider, depending on their orientation. Vertical stripes can add height, while horizontal stripes can create a more expansive feel. Mix colors or widths for a more dynamic look that’s still timeless.4. Textured Wall TreatmentsConsider adding texture to your walls with materials like wood paneling, stone, or even textured paint. These elements can add depth and warmth to your living room. A reclaimed wood accent wall, for instance, can provide a cozy, rustic vibe that’s perfect for relaxation.5. Statement Art and MuralsSometimes, the best wall pattern is a large piece of art or a mural. This can be a hand-painted design or a wall decal that reflects your personality.
